Description
The use of ordinary e-mail, which is the undisputed central electronic communication tool for business communication, is confronted with the fact that the authenticity and integrity of the message as well as the proof of delivery cannot be guaranteed. De-Mail is meant to ensure these effects in an easy-to-handle manner. By comparing the technical, organisational and legal foundations of the conventional e-mail on the one hand and the De-Mail on the other hand, the study addresses the question whether the De-Mail in its legal framework provided by the De-Mail Act and other legislative acts achieves this objective.
